Magnetic Door Locks and Access Control

magnetic door lock

Magnetic door locks, commonly known as maglocks, are a reliable and effective solution for securing openings. The Anatomy of Magnetic Door Locks:

Magnetic door locks comprise an electromagnet and an armature. Typically, you mount the electromagnet on the frame and attach the armature to the door. When the door closes, the armature connects to the magnet, and a constant power source maintains the magnetic force, securely holding the door shut.

Fail-Safe Operation:

One key feature of magnetic locks is their fail-safe operation. In the event of a power failure or interruption, the magnet releases, allowing free movement through the opening. This fail-safe design is particularly important for emergency situations, requiring integration with fire alarm, automatic fire detection, or sprinkler systems. Activation of these systems cuts power to the lock, releasing the magnetic force for swift egress.

Safely Managing Magnetic Locks:

To ensure the safe operation of maglocks, additional components are necessary. Two main types of magnetic locks are commonly used:

  1. Sensor Controlled Magnetic Locks:

A sensor or detector on the egress side signals the maglock to release when it senses a person approaching. Additionally, a manually operated emergency button or pull station provides immediate power cut, allowing free egress during emergencies. Proper positioning and clear signage are crucial for compliance with building codes.

  1. Hardware Controlled Magnetic Locks:

Hardware mounted on the egress side directly controls the maglock. The lock releases when the hardware is used or in case of a power loss. This hardware should have a clear and easily operable method, meeting specific criteria for motion and accessibility.

Considerations for Implementation:

Before incorporating a magnetic door lock into your security system, consider the following:

  • Is it an exterior door?
  • Will the door be electronically locked?
  • Is the opening a path of egress?
  • Is it a double leaf door or a double egress opening?
  • Are the doors made of tempered glass without a frame or mullion?
  • Does the door exit a high-hazard room or building?

Compliance and Expert Guidance:

Magnetic locks must comply with local, state, and national fire and building codes. Local Authorities Having Jurisdiction (AHJ) will require electrical plans and permits to ensure safe egress under all conditions.
